SUBJECT/RECOMMENDATION:
Title
Return to service four roll-off trucks and one front-end loading truck (for refuse collection from dumpsters) that were previously declared as surplus and authorized for sale Pursuant to Chapter 2 Article VI, Division 4, Section 2.622, and authorize the appropriate officials to execute same. (consent)
Body
SUMMARY:
The five vehicles listed below were intended to be removed from service as their replacements came on-line. Due to the closing of the Transfer Station and the critical need to retain these vehicles to assist in the direct hauling of waste to the Pinellas County waste-to-energy plant, the Solid Waste Department is requesting that Council declare these items as restored to service. Once the Transfer Station is re-opened (fall or winter of 2019/2020) the vehicles will be recommended for disposal as surplus equipment.
1. G2787 2003 Sterling Roll-Off Truck
2. G3039 2004 Peterbilt Roll-Off Truck
3. G3277 2006 Kenworth Roll-Off Truck
4. G3278 2007 Kenworth Roll-Off Truck
5. G3618 2008 Peterbilt Front-End Loading Truck
